Distance and duration of the flight
The distance between Manchester and Egypt is approximately 2,800 miles (4,500 km). The flight duration can vary depending on the airline, route, and any layovers. On average, the flight time from Manchester to Cairo is around 5-6 hours. However, flights to other cities in Egypt, such as Hurghada or Sharm El Sheikh, may take longer due to additional travel time from the airport.
